EDITORS COMMENTS
This print showcases an original drawing by the renowned Spanish doctor and histologist, Santiago Ramon y Cajal (1852-1934). Known for his groundbreaking work in neuroscience, Cajal was awarded the Nobel Prize in Physiology or Medicine in 1906 for his discoveries regarding the structure of the nervous system. The drawing depicts a histological schema of the spinal cord, meticulously rendered in rich, vibrant colors. The image was created during Cajal's tenure at the Faculty of Medicine in Madrid, part of the Complutense University of Madrid.
